    Yet another "My First Saber" post. I'd use its name, but the thing doesn't have one yet. Coincidentally this is my first post, so yay me. Hello all.



    Three Brass Sink Pipes
    One PVC Sink Pipe
    Seoul P4 Blue
    1000mA Buckpuck
    No sound
    Vandal Resistant Switch

    I started this project after finals last December and only just finished this week (took forever for there to be a Saturday that was both warm enough to paint yet not raining). At least, I finished it as much as one's first saber can be finished. I lack the skill to really make it perfect, so maybe one day I'll revisit the design and make a version 2.0.

    I spent four years practicing Iaido before grad school (one of the Japanese sword arts, specifically one that uses actual swords), so I wanted to create a lightsaber that could be wielded similarly. A high grip and a couple of angles were my only starting points, everything else just kinda happened. Special thanks to Gundam for the inspiration link, and to everyone in the forum.

    It's still unnamed (I really stink at such things), so any suggestions would be welcome. I'm kinda going for a cold justice theme, but I'm open to anything at this point.
